M10 Dimensional Row (ISO 7042 / DIN 980)

SizePitch (mm)Width across flats s (mm)Nut height m (mm)Reference standardNotes
M101.516.011.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able

When to Step Up or Down from M10

When the joint preload approaches the proof load of M10 class 8.8, step up to M12 class 8.8 (or move to M10 class 10.9). When the joint is over-specified, M8 often saves weight and cost without losing the safety margin.

Dimensions & Specifications (ISO 7042 / DIN 980)

SizePitch (mm)Width across flats s (mm)Nut height m (mm)Reference standardNotes
M50.88.06.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M61.010.07.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M81.2513.09.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M101.516.011.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M121.7518.013.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M142.021.015.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M162.024.017.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M182.527.019.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M202.530.021.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M243.036.024.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M303.546.030.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able
M364.055.036.0ISO 7042 / DIN 980Deformed-top locking, high-temperature capable

What is the coarse-thread pitch of M10 for All-Metal Lock Nuts?

For M10 the standard coarse pitch is 1.5 mm — this is the value used for All-Metal Lock Nuts.

What clearance and tapping drill suit M10?

Use a 11 mm clearance hole (ISO 273 medium) for through-fixing, or a 8.5 mm tapping drill for a coarse M10 thread.
